TīmeklisLang Jawoll Superwash $10.00 Content: 75% Superwash Wool, 25% Nylon Yarn weight: Fingering Gauge: 28-30 sts = 4” Needle size: 2.25-3.5mm / 1-4 US Yardage: 230yds / 210m = 50g Care: Machine wash wool cycle, air dry Feels like: Round, smooth. Use for: Socks! Sweaters, shawls, and hats, too! TīmeklisJawoll - the sock wool classic, tried, tested and approved for many years - includes heel re-inforcement yarn to strengthen heels and toes to lengthen the life of your socks! 75% Superwash Wool, 25% Nylon 210m on a 50 gram ball ... TīmeklisDue to the superior quality of the fibers, Jawoll Silk Superwash is also excellent for baby or toddler knits and for men's knitwear. Fiber Content: 55% Corriedale Wool, 25% Nylon, and 20% Tussah Silk. Yardage: 218 Yards in each 50 gram skein. Gauge: Approximately 7 stitches to an inch on U.S. size 1-2 (2.25-2.75mm) needles.
